Q. What is the Drugs and Cosmetics Act?

Ans.

Drugs and Cosmetics Act is a law that regulates the import, manufacture, distribution, and sale of drugs and cosmetics in India.

  • The act was passed in 1940 and has been amended several times since then.

  • It sets standards for the quality, safety, and efficacy of drugs and cosmetics.

  • It requires manufacturers to obtain licenses and follow certain procedures for testing, labeling, and packaging.

Q. What are the responsibilities of a pharmacist?

Ans.

A pharmacist is responsible for dispensing medications, providing drug information, and ensuring patient safety.

  • Dispensing medications prescribed by doctors

  • Providing drug information to patients and healthcare professionals

  • Ensuring patient safety by checking for drug interactions and allergies

  • Compounding medications for patients with unique needs

  • Managing inventory and ordering medications

  • Collaborating with healthcare professionals to optimize patient care

    Q. What are the classes of medicines?

    Ans.

    There are several classes of medicines including antibiotics, analgesics, antihistamines, and antidepressants.

    • Antibiotics are used to treat bacterial infections

    • Analgesics are used to relieve pain

    • Antihistamines are used to treat allergies

    • Antidepressants are used to treat depression and anxiety

    • Other classes include antipsychotics, anticonvulsants, and diuretics

    Q. Classification of antibiotics?

    Ans.

    Antibiotics are classified into several categories based on their mechanism of action and chemical structure.

    • Antibiotics can be classified based on their target organism (bacteria, fungi, viruses, etc.)

    • They can also be classified based on their chemical structure (penicillins, cephalosporins, macrolides, etc.)

    • Another way to classify antibiotics is based on their mechanism of action (inhibition of cell wall synthesis, inhibition of protein synthesis, etc.)
